Shame-and-honor societies conceal from public view the authentic sentiments of their people.
Duplicity is the standard by which people engage with each other. It is unsafe for people to take firm positions on any matter so long as it is unclear who will be the dominant power in the situation.
The social situation cannot stabilize the way it can in societies that govern on the basis of authority because the personal power dynamics in any given situation will almost always be more fluid than the dynamics of law and the alliances based on the expression of delegated power, which is the essence of authority.
